Has anyone else seen this show? It popped up on my log-in for NetFlix last night so I watched the trailer. I thought it looked so good that I showed it to my boyfriend and he liked it too. We ended up watching the first 2 episodes instead of my doing my damn homework then I had to stop because it was getting late & had to get back to the homework. What are your thoughts of it?